I know artwork and designs pop up from time to time for all kinds of things. I don't think I have ever come across what the packaging for the Mad Bubbler figure was going to look like. Has anyone ever seen it? or come across it? I know Hollywood Heroes always auctions off artwork from the LJN line, was that ever something they may have auctioned off??? I am just curious, because the size of the figure would have called for an interesting packaging unless it would have just been put on a card semi awkwardly, like the Berserkers. Just curious. Anyone have any info?

When i collected original LJN art and prototypes i never saw any box art for that character. I think the Bubbler was cancelled from full production before they could work out box art. The never used box art for the Astral Moat Monster probably shows clues to how Bubbler packaging might have been.
